5 Reasons Why Retail Brands Should Harness Online Marketplaces for Growth

By Laura Garrett

Online marketplaces are quickly dominating the retail sphere. With ecommerce becoming more popular in every sector as time goes on, this trend is here to stay. Research showed that in 2019, 57% of all online sales took place via a digital marketplace. Additionally, the COVID-19 pandemic led unprecedented amounts of people to turn to online shopping to fulfill their consumer needs due to public health measures that kept people at home. Plus, it’s likely to assume that this figure has risen since then.

Industry insiders have noted that these platforms are attractive not only to consumers but retailers too. Marketplaces offer an opportunity for shoppers to access a number of their favorite brands all under one roof. At the same time, retailers can more easily scale up their sales operations by utilizing marketplaces, stepping more smoothly into new markets, and tapping into new consumer bases. #1. Grow your consumer base quickly and effectively

A major benefit of selling through digital marketplaces is that it’s a quick and easy way to introduce and grow brand awareness in both new and existing markets. If your brand is new to a certain region, it is highly likely that a range of marketplace players will already be established and popular in that location.  

Selling through marketplaces will therefore provide increased marketing opportunities and help raise brand awareness within an unfamiliar market. The association with an already trusted and established platform will give new customers the confidence they need to purchase from an unknown name. This way, you’re able to save on marketing costs, using a shortcut to meet new audiences on the sites they’re already visiting frequently.

#2. Integrate easily with an existing customer-friendly setup

Setting up operations in a new country or region is often complex and costly. When stepping into a new market, selling through an existing platform simplifies the process, and in most cases, saves both time and money while securing the best solutions for both you and your customers.

Online marketplace giants have both the experience and expertise to drive growth for your brand amongst new customers, with the logistical, technological, and operational network already in place. Plus, they offer a customer-friendly setup with regards to both the sales and returns processes, alongside customer experience management. For many stand-alone brands, the complexity and wide-reaching coordination needed to launch in a new forum is overwhelming. With everything from sales to returns, online marketplaces offer a turnkey solution for a smooth scale-up operation.  

#3. Tailor your product selection for a particular market

Digital marketplaces offer a stage on which you can showcase a particular product selection to a new audience. Win the attention of new consumers by promoting your global best-sellers or find out what items are most popular in any given region. Marketplaces provide an opportunity to experiment and learn what works best in each market. You can use this to grow in the future and encourage future sales, adding more items to stock that you know for sure your new consumer base will be receptive to.

#4. Gain access to established market data and insights

With a variety of brands and products onboard, online marketplaces are able to tap into vast amounts of market data regarding consumer behavior and shopping trends. Selling on these platforms gives merchants access to these valuable insights and expertise.  

This data can inform future business decisions and help to improve operations. For example, online marketplaces often have integrated features designed to use customer feedback to improve the sales process. For example, on many platforms, customers may leave reviews on products or be required to state the reason for a return. Information such as this informs brands of where they can improve, perhaps in terms of sizing or product quality etc. Using data to fix commonly reported issues promotes future growth. 

#5. Simplify customer service responsibilities

Another integration made possible by partnering with an online marketplace is customer service capabilities. Very often, these platforms have their own customer outreach channels, such as web chat, phone, or email to help consumers with any issues they may experience during the sale or return process. Having access to this not only provides shoppers buying your goods with a great customer experience but also saves your brand time and money on these often costly resources. An existing setup takes the complexity out of launching in a new market, diminishing the need to form an in-house customer service operation in that region.
